What is process engineering?
Process engineering is essentially the application of chemical engineering principles to optimise the design, operation and control of chemical processes. Since this requires equipment design and selection, mechanical engineers may also be employed as process engineers.

What is the difference between biochemical and chemical engineering?
Chemical engineering is concerned with changing raw materials into useful products by designing processes which change their chemical or physical composition, structure or energy content. Biochemical engineering is a branch of chemical engineering which is concerned with biological changes and is particularly important in the production of pharmaceuticals, foodstuffs and the treatment of waste.

What is the difference between chemistry and chemical engineering?
Chemistry investigates the background of the science encompassing aspects of; organic, inorganic, analytical, physical, and bio-chemistry. What does a chemical engineer earn?
Chemical engineers are the best paid group of engineers. According to an annual salary survey of IChemE members, those under the age of 25 earn £30,000/y on average. More details about the salaries for chemical engineers can be found on our salary survey page.

What sort of jobs can I do with a chemical engineering degree?
The choice of work available is exceptionally wide. Chemical engineers work in large international companies, as well as smaller companies; in sectors as wide ranging as chemicals, oil and gas, pharmaceuticals, food and drink, biotechnology and water. They are also highly sought after in business and finance.

What does the work involve?
Chemical engineers are trained to apply fundamental engineering principles to design, develop and manage processes while maximising economic returns and reducing environmental impact. Chemical engineers need to work as part of a team and develop good communication skills. Strong problem-solving and analytical skills are also a bonus.
